Position Overview
We are seeking a highly skilled Hardware Design Engineer to join our team and contribute to the development of THz transceivers and evaluation platforms from concept through volume production. The ideal candidate has experience in high-speed circuit design, signal and power integrity, and RF component and SERDES integration. The candidate must be eligible and available to work on-site in Ottawa, ON.
Key Responsibilities
Develop hardware transceiver modules and evaluation platforms, including PCB design and component selection.
Design high-speed analog, digital and power circuits.
Create detailed design documentation, schematics, and BOMs.
Develop test plans and perform validation in lab environment.
Collaborate with mechanical, firmware, ASIC and system teams to ensure seamless integration and functionality.
Drive design reviews with cross-functional and manufacturing teams.
Support troubleshooting and failure analysis during prototype and production phases.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Electronics, or related field.
5+ years of experience in hardware design for optical or RF communication systems.
Proficiency in high-speed PCB design tools (Cadence preferred).
Hands-on experience with lab equipment (oscilloscopes, VNAs, spectrum analyzers).
Experience with SerDes, PAM4, or other high-speed signaling technologies.
Knowledge of thermal management and EMI/EMC compliance.
